How Ira Vs Roth Ira Vs 401k Actually Works
Key Insights
An IRAβwhether traditional or Rothβlets individuals set aside pre-tax or after-tax dollars with unique retirement advantages. Traditional IRAs offer tax-deferred growth, meaning contributions may reduce current taxable income;
